Another way is to change the client's noallwrite option to "allwrite"
when Perforce does a sync, it will keep all files as writable.
HOWEVER, this isn't recommended. Just because you changed a file
doesn't mean that it will be submitted. To submit a file, you first
must assign it to a changelist, and that is done via the "p4 edit" or
"p4 reopen" command.

> Once we submit the files to depot and sync them on the client depot, original
> permissions of the files are lost.
> i.e. earlier to p4 submit
> -Bash-3.00$ ls -l 1.c
> -rw-r--r-- 1 rashmi users 0 Jun 8 05:25 1.c
> After submit and refreshing the client work space
> -r--r--r-- 1 rashmi users 2832 Jun 8 06:42 1.c
> What do we have to do have the same file permissions even after submitting to
> the depot and syncing it in client work space
